Web13 de jul. de 2007 · It’s an alto sax mouthpiece fitted to a length of PVC tubing that has fingerholes drilled so as to play a Highland pipe scale using normal Highland pipe fingering. They are available in A, B flat (at normal pitch), and a high-pitched B flat (around ten cents sharp) to match modern Highland pipes. WebHighland Hornpipe in A. $ 350.00. GHB Carbony™ Highland Hornpipe with engraved Stainless Steel sole pitched at A = 440. Ebonite saxophone mouthpiece on a chanter fingered body. An unkeyed, wooden barrel with a bell made of horn. You can purchase a modern plastic version here: http://www.highlandhornpipe.com/ A number of baroque composers actually wrote for the hornpipe, most notably Handel in his Water Music Suite.
